#include #include

int main() { LPCWSTR str = L'Hello World'; std::wstring result;

for (int i = 0; str[i] != '\0'; i++) {
    result += str[i];
}

std::wcout << result << std::endl;

return 0;

}

在这个示例中,我们首先定义了一个 LPCWSTR 类型的字符串 'str',其值为 'L"Hello World"'。然后,我们创建了一个 wstring 类型的变量 'result',用于存储最终的结果。

接下来,我们使用一个 for 循环来遍历 'str' 中的每个字符。在每次循环中,我们将当前字符添加到 'result' 中,通过使用 '+=' 运算符来实现。

最后,我们使用 'std::wcout' 输出 'result' 的值,以便在控制台上显示结果。

C++ 代码:将 LPCWSTR 字符串逐个添加到 wstring 变量

原文地址: https://www.cveoy.top/t/topic/o6ED 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录